  3. Looks like the steerer was cut down quite a bit for that frame so the key slot is missing. The ln either the keyed washer was wearing a flat, or someone flatted the threads for a french style flatted washer.
    Be mindful of that crack in the top of the steerer.

  4. The material needed to cut threads onto has been ground away, it’s literally not there anymore.

    You would need to get new material welded on then turned down to the correct size then have it rethreaded. The cost of this would probably exceed the cost of a new fork
